In Chinese astrology, the Horse is naturally associated with the Fire element, so when the calendar itself is ruled by Fire, that creates what many practitioners call Double Fire energy. Fire stands for vitality, bold action and even impatience, while the Horse symbolises freedom, momentum and ambition. Put together in 2026, this blend is said to dismantle stagnant situations and push people to move fast, sometimes in ways that feel abrupt or intense.
Astrologers highlight that this is not a calm, slow-building influence, but one that rewards quick decisions, initiative and visible leadership. Specific technical breakdowns of the element stems and branches for 2026 may vary by school of astrology and are not fully standardised across all sources.
The Fire Horse year starts with Lunar New Year on February 17, 2026, marking the official beginning of this high‑energy cycle. Experts describe the Fire Horse as “very special” because it merges two dynamic symbols and only repeats every 60 years in the zodiac cycle. This Double Fire pattern is associated with rapid transformation, upheaval and strong emotional reactions, both at a personal and collective level.
Commentators point to past Fire Horse periods as times of social change and disruption, although detailed historical correlations differ between authors and are not fully agreed upon. For daily life, the message is clear: expect acceleration, heightened passion and less tolerance for half-hearted choices.

In the Chinese Zodiac, the Horse is naturally a fire element sign. Since 2026 is specifically a “Fire Horse” year in the 60-year cycle, the fire element is doubled, creating an exceptionally powerful and intense energetic atmosphere.
The last Fire Horse year occurred in 1966. Because this specific elemental combination only happens every 60 years, 2026 is considered a rare and pivotal time for personal growth and global shifts.
People born under this sign are known for being incredibly independent, charismatic, and courageous. However, the “double fire” energy can also make them more impulsive or prone to quick tempers.
It is a year of “high risk, high reward.” While it brings great opportunities for those who are bold and decisive, it also requires extra mindfulness to avoid burnout and emotional volatility.
When the Fire element (Li-type Chi) is in excess, it can manifest as anxiety, irritability, or burnout. At home, an imbalance of fire can lead to arguments or a feeling of constant restlessness. It is vital to balance this energy in order to harness the creativity of the Fire Horse without succumbing to its destructive nature.
The area associated with Fire is the South (fame and reputation). However, since 2026 is already extremely “hot,” avoid placing candles or bright lights in the South. Instead, place items that represent your goals but with colors that calm the fire, such as a picture of your successes in a silver or metal frame (Metal element).
